Active Record

  • Change QueryMethods#in_order_of to drop records not listed in values.

    in_order_of now filters down to the values provided, to match the behavior of the Enumerable version.

    Kevin Newton

  • Allow named expression indexes to be revertible.

    Previously, the following code would raise an error in a reversible migration executed while rolling back, due to the index name not being used in the index removal.

    add_index(:settings, "(data->'property')", using: :gin, name: :index_settings_data_property)

    Fixes #43331.

    Oliver Günther

  • Better error messages when association name is invalid in the argument of ActiveRecord::QueryMethods::WhereChain#missing.

    ykpythemind

  • Fix ordered migrations for single db in multi db environment.

    Himanshu

  • Extract on update CURRENT_TIMESTAMP for mysql2 adapter.

    Kazuhiro Masuda

Rails 7.0.1 (January 06, 2022)

  • Allow testing discard_on/retry_on ActiveJob::DeserializationError

    Previously in perform_enqueued_jobs, deserialize_arguments_if_needed was called before calling perform_now. When a record no longer exists and is serialized using GlobalID this led to raising an ActiveJob::DeserializationError before reaching perform_now call. This behaviour makes difficult testing the job discard_on/retry_on logic.

    Now deserialize_arguments_if_needed call is postponed to when perform_now is called.

    Example:

    class UpdateUserJob < ActiveJob::Base
      discard_on ActiveJob::DeserializationError
    def perform(user)
    # ...
    end
    end
    In the test
    User.destroy_all
    assert_nothing_raised do
    perform_enqueued_jobs only: UpdateUserJob
    end

    Jacopo Beschi
